Abstract
The research results of autodyne signal formed under reflection of semiconductor laser radiation from vibration reflector have been presented. The influence of feedback coefficient and distance to vibration object on autodyne signal form has been shown. The method of reverse problem solution in autodyne interferometry of nonharmonical vibrations has been described. The suggested method allows to restore the amplitude and form of mechanical vibrations for autodyne system developed for interference system separated from the light source.
